Commercial Description:
Dark malts provide flavors of coffee and dried fruit. Recommended serving temperature 10°C/50°F. Try with dark chocolate, cheese, or red meat dishes.

Ingredients: Maris Otter, Munich, caramel, black malt, and chocolate malt; Centennial and Northern Brewer hops; English ale yeast, and our local Grimstad water.

16.5° P, 30 IBU, 7 ABV.

500ml bottle, 28th Feb 2008. Pours pure black with a tan head. Aroma of medicinal herbs and toasted malt, with coffee and fruity hints. Great aroma of dark roasted malt, camphor, salty liquorice and bitter chocolate and coffee. Perfectly smooth as it goes down. Great stuff!

1 pt .9 fl oz bottle from Blue Max in Burnsville, MN. Pour is a deep brown with red highlights. Head is khaki and about 1/2 inch tall. Aroma is licorice, hops and roasted malt. The taste starts with a very nice roastiness, plenty of malt, some hop bitterness and then finishes with a strong coffee flavor. Really nice palate to this one, solid, but not overly huge. Really picks up flavor as it warms. Nice beer.

Hadn’t really expected much with this and was really suprised to find out how dry the beer was. There was really very little sweetness left, just a lot of ashy/roasted notes that I didn’t find all that enjoyable. The beer looked great though. A nice thick black liquid with a creamy tan foamy head. Aroma smelled a lot like coffee too, with some dark chocolate notes too. I know I’m unabashed in my love of stouts, especially those on the sweeter side of things. This beer was clearly on the other end of the spectrum. But still, I did enjoy the beer and would get it again.
